The regression entered with the 3.9 ledger refactor, which changed the mutation hook signature; plugins compiled against the older SDK no longer registered their transactions. External plugin authors should recompile against SDK 3.9.1 and verify that undo round-trips their custom shapes before republishing. The ledger build in which the fix first appears is recorded below.

pipeline stamp: htk31_f769b577b3028a4e9958e5bb8d1259a

## Local Setup

Welcome aboard. To reproduce the session-token refresh bug in Lanternkit, run the auth service locally with the `stale-refresh` fixture enabled. The bug only appears when a token refresh overlaps a session expiry, so set the TTL to 30 seconds in your local config. Seed the sessions table with `make seed-sessions` before starting, otherwise refreshes will always succeed and you will see nothing. The local database to point the service at is listed below.

warehouse DSN: clickhouse://druys_svc:Pl@db-47e1.orvexstack.corp:5432/beldor

## Welcome to the Marmot Refactor

So you've inherited our legacy ORM layer — sorry in advance. We're slowly migrating the old Quillbase models over to the new repository pattern, one module at a time. Rule of thumb: don't add new logic to `legacy/models`, and always write a shim test first. To get the migration scripts running locally, your `.env` needs the database credential, which goes right here:

secret setting of yagef-baweg: RELAY_SECRET29=cb53deb59a49ed54d9f43599b54ca